Output 2537d8db279b039890666fc5382a0c263b8747f1f39327f38f2e5e6705180708:3

value
14500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5556b21c39c13a416c71ef6e6452d976c2eb80dc OP_EQUAL
address
39UFDaKA2WVpWmnDREnUUSXj7m5izqJ3RH
transaction
2537d8db279b039890666fc5382a0c263b8747f1f39327f38f2e5e6705180708
confirmations
153740
spent
true